Sep 14, 2023Perennial is yet another step forward for Woods, a band that continues to get stronger as their music becomes gentler and more graceful.
-
MojoSep 14, 2023Organic, evergreen loveliness. [Oct 2023, p.88]
-
Sep 14, 2023The real highlights for Woods this go around are the four instrumental efforts that each have a distinct vibe yet are linked spiritually. Rather than acting as placeholders they take root as distinct works.
-
UncutSep 14, 2023The abundance of dreamy, placid wonders like "Between The Past" and the instrumental "White Wonder Melody" doesn't entirely negate one's longing for more of the ferocious, Ira Kaplan-worthy shredding that fills the final moments of "Another Dream" or other touches that add a wobblier, woozier feel to the proceedings. [Oct 2023, p.37]
-
Oct 12, 2023With 11 tracks at 44 minutes, it feels more affirmed and settled, neither breaking fresh ground nor uncritically repeating past ideas.
-
Sep 28, 2023Perennial is an easy-flowing new collection of songs, including a number of dynamic instrumentals, which showcase the chemistry among the players.
